Tackling
| Drill | Description | Key Learnings |
|---|---|---|
| Tackle - Warmup | Small collection of low-impact tackle warmup drills | Tackling fundamentals and repetition |
| Shoulder tag to shoulder contact | Progress from tags to shoulder contact with wrap. | Head placement safety Footwork into contact Strong squeeze-and-finish |
| Chop tackle and jackal support | Low chop with immediate second-player jackal simulation. | “Hit-through” at thighs Roll clear vs contest cues Arrive and clamp |
| Track-and-shepherd channel | Defender angles carrier to touchline, then tackle. | Angle of approach Patience and spacing Tackle choice near touch |
| Dominant double hits | Two defenders coordinate high-control + low-chop finish. | Primary/secondary roles Communication Dominance without penalties |
| Tackle-to-feet recovery race | After tackle, bounce to feet, reload to next contact. | Quick post-tackle roll/reload Spatial awareness Defensive work-rate |
| Tackle Decision Reactions Drill | Decision-making and reaction to adjust feet and direction to make effective front-on tackle on correct attacker. | Speed off the line in defence Decision-making under pressure Chopping feet to 'tread water' before committing to tackle Body control for effective tackle execution depending on attacker speed/direction |
